Output 53e95d28a4af4c314ec21247670d4011537f21ba8582c0b53d938c515ba5c089:0

value
1516457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6713be14a76360fa79d83f7dbe1c1e09fc5ecf81 OP_EQUAL
address
3B63B31QRBbzvVmFgNPuw6JdmsV298eQWY
transaction
53e95d28a4af4c314ec21247670d4011537f21ba8582c0b53d938c515ba5c089
spent
true